## Timezone Tuning

Exports in Gridmoor render timestamps in the workspace timezone, falling back to UTC when unset. DST transitions are resolved at render time, not ingestion. Reviewers: confirm no export path bypasses the normalizer, and that ambiguous local times follow the documented fold rule. The constants governing fallback, fold handling, and cache lifetime are listed below.

tuning table, yajog-yahof:
BUDGETS = {
    "lamvan": 303,
    "wenox": 460,
    "fenvan": 525,
}

// REINDEX_BATCH_CAP limits docs per shard pass in the Tallowfield
// nightly search reindex. Raising it starves the ingest queue;
// lowering it overruns the maintenance window. 5000 is the tested
// sweet spot. Change only with a soak run. Verified against the
// build noted below.

session token of bawif-hahog = htk6_ac5981

MEMO — Gross-Margin Review, Q3

To the incoming director: our review of the Fennick product line shows margin compression of 2.4 points, driven chiefly by freight surcharges and discounting at the Westholm branch. Corrective pricing takes effect next quarter, and we expect partial recovery by spring. Full workings are attached for your reference. Please read the confidential planning note appended directly below this memo.

board note of bajop-yaweg: The western region missed its Pelys quota by 58.0 percent last quarter. Pelysek Foods plans to raise the Belius list price by 44.0 percent in July. The steering committee signed off on a budget of $133.8 million for Project Pelax. The renewal with Zoraelix Systems closes at $61.9 million a year, 12.7 percent above the last contract.

# Session Handling: Retention Sweeper

The Lumenreach retention sweeper runs nightly against the session store, expiring records older than 90 days and writing tombstones for audit. Release managers must confirm the sweeper completed before tagging a release, since partial sweeps can leave orphaned session shards that break migration scripts. Check the `sweep_status` endpoint on the Drossel cluster; a green status within the last 24 hours is required. For manual verification calls, use the bearer token provided below.

session JWT of yawep-yawep = eyJhbGciOiJIUzI1NiIsInR5cCI6IkpXVCJ9.eyJzdWIiOiI3pWF3_In0.aXYsHiog